Filing 249 ORDER Denying 248 Defendants' Ex Parte Application to Modify Briefing Schedule in ECF 243 . Signed by Judge Todd W. Robinson on 6/21/2022. (All non-registered users served via U.S. Mail Service)(ave) |
Filing 243 Order (1) Denying Motions For Reconsideration Of The Order On SummaryJudgment, And (2) To Show Cause Why Summary Judgment Should Not BeGranted On Qualified Immunity Grounds (ECF Nos. 230 , 233 ). The Parties SHALL FILE their respective briefs addr essing whether or not Defendants are entitled to qualified immunity as to Plaintiff's First Amendment claim relating to the opening of his legal mail outside his presence on or before Friday, June 24, 2022. Signed by Judge Todd W. Robinson on 5/10/2022. (All non-registered users served via U.S. Mail Service) (fth) |
Filing 222 ORDER granting in part and denying in part 167 Motion for Summary Judgment. The Court DIRECTS the Clerk of Court to terminated Defendants Swain, Brown, John and Jane Does, and Rohrer from the Court's Docket. The Court DENIES Defendants' ; Motion as to Plaintiff's First Amendment claims based on the opening of his legal mail outside his presence but GRANTS Defendants' Motion as to all remaining claims in Plaintiff's First Amended Complaint. Signed by Judge Todd W. Robinson on 2/8/2022. (All non-registered users served via U.S. Mail Service)(fth) |

Filing 61 ORDER (1) Adopting 47 Report and Recommendation; and (2) Granting in part and Denying in part 32 Motion to Dismiss. It is ordered, Claim 1 of Plaintiff's Complaint is dismissed with prejudice. The Court finds that no amendment can cure the claim preclusion bar of this claim, and Plaintiff is not granted leave to amend this claim. In contrast, all claims against Defendant Kernan are dismissed without prejudice. The remainder of Defendants' Motion to Dismiss is denied. Signed by Judge Janis L. Sammartino on 7/11/2018. (All non-registered users served via U.S. Mail Service)(mpl) |

Filing 6 ORDER: (1) Granting 2 Motion to Proceed in Forma Pauperis And 3 Motion for Leave to File Excess Pages; (2) Dismissing Complaint for Failing to State a Claim; And (3) Denying 5 Motion for Preliminary Injunction And/or Protective Order. The Se cretary CDCR, or his designee, is ordered to collect from prison trust account the $350 balance of the filing fee owed in this case by collecting monthly payments from the trust account in an amount equal to 20% of the preceding month incom e credited to the account and forward payments to the Clerk of the Court each time the amount in the account exceeds $10 in accordance with 28 USC 1915(b)(2). (Order electronically transmitted to Secretary of CDCR.) The Court grants plaintiff f orty-five (45) days leave from the date of this Order in which to file an Amended Complaint which cures all the noted pleading deficiencies. Plaintiff's Amended Complaint must be complete by itself without reference to his original pleading. Defendants not named and any claim not re-alleged in his Amended Complaint will be considered waived. If Plaintiff fails to file an Amended Complaint within the time provided, the Court will enter a final Order dismissing this civil action base d both on Plaintiff's failure to state a claim upon which relief can be granted pursuant to 28 U.S.C. §§ 1915(e)(2) and 1915A(b), and his failure to prosecute in compliance with a court order requiring amendment. Signed by Judge Janis L. Sammartino on 5/16/2017. (All non-registered users served via U.S. Mail Service)(dxj) |
